Origins of Mostar

  • Mostar began as a small settlement in the 15th century near a crossing over the Neretva River.
  • Its name comes from “mostari” (bridge keepers) who guarded the crossing.
  • It grew under the Ottoman Empire (from 1468) into an important frontier town.

Construction of Stari Most (16th Century)

  • Built in 1566 during the rule of Sultan Suleiman the Magnificent.
  • Designed by Mimar Hayruddin, a student of the famous Ottoman architect Sinan.
  • Replaced an earlier wooden bridge and became a masterpiece of Ottoman engineering.
  • The bridge’s elegant stone arch symbolized connection between cultures, religions, and communities.

Destruction in the 1990s War

  • During the Bosnian War, the bridge was destroyed on 9 November 1993 after heavy shelling.
  • Its destruction was seen worldwide as a loss of cultural heritage and unity.

Reconstruction and Modern Significance

  • Rebuilt between 2001–2004 using original techniques and materials.
  • Supported by international organizations including UNESCO and the World Bank.
  • Today it is a UNESCO World Heritage Site (since 2005) and a symbol of:
    • reconciliation
    • multicultural coexistence
    • resilience after conflict

Cultural Importance Today

  • Famous for the tradition of diving from the bridge, dating back centuries.
  • One of the most recognizable landmarks in Bosnia and Herzegovina.
  • Represents the meeting point of different religions, cultures, and histories.
